TURN-208: Gatevale turnstile counters at the Merrow Field pilot double-count when a rotation reverses mid-cycle. Attendance totals drift roughly 2% high per event. The debounce window fix is implemented, reviewed by Ilsa, and soak-tested across two simulated match days without drift. Ready for your cut; the candidate build is identified below.

trace token, tagag-tafog: htk6_5ed18c

Support team: the Quillbase nightly reindex runs at 02:00 and takes about 40 minutes. Search results may be stale during that window; tell customers to retry after 03:00. If the reindex stalls, escalate to the Findery on-call. Restarting the indexer requires the ops vault, which unlocks with the passphrase that follows.

recovery phrase for fajeg-hagug: holox-fenmir

## Changelog — Ticktrace 1.9

### Renamed: DRIFT_API_TOKEN
During the cron drift investigation we found plugins confusing this variable with the metrics token, so it has been renamed to indicate it authorizes drift-report uploads specifically. Plugin authors must read the new name from 1.9 onward; the old name is ignored without warning. Sample env files in the SDK are updated. In your deployment env file, the drift-report upload secret is set on the next line.

env line for fawef-taguf: VAULT_KEY13=a9695905a9a90